The INVT GD270-1R5-4 is a 1.5kW advanced vector drive from INVT's GD270 series, representing the next-generation high-performance platform for precision industrial motor control. Designed for three-phase 380V input, this sophisticated drive delivers superior vector control performance with open-loop and closed-loop capability, PM motor support, and an integrated PLC for standalone intelligent control in a compact package. With built-in DC reactor, enhanced EMC filter, Modbus RTU plus optional fieldbus cards, LCD keypad with multi-language support, and comprehensive protection, it is the ideal premium drive solution for machine tools, winding/unwinding, packaging, conveyors, textile machinery, and precise automation applications where advanced control intelligence and compact performance are required.
| Model | GD270-1R5-4 |
|---|---|
| Series | INVT GD270 Advanced Vector Drive |
| Rated Power | 1.5 kW (2 HP) — G-Type Constant Torque |
| Input Voltage | 3-Phase 380–480V AC, 50/60Hz |
| Rated Input Current | 5.0 A |
| Rated Output Current | 3.8 A (constant torque / heavy-duty) |
| Output Frequency Range | 0.00–600.00 Hz (vector), up to 3000Hz (V/F) |
| Frequency Resolution | 0.01 Hz (digital reference), 0.1% max frequency (analog) |
| Control Mode | V/F, Open-Loop Vector (SVC), Closed-Loop Vector (FVC), PMSM Sensorless Vector, Torque Control |
| Starting Torque | SVC: 150% at 0.5Hz / FVC: 180% at 0Hz |
| Speed Control Range | SVC: 1:100 / FVC: 1:1000 |
| Speed Control Accuracy | SVC: ±0.2% rated speed / FVC: ±0.02% rated speed |
| Torque Control Accuracy | SVC: ±5% / FVC: ±3% |
| Overload Capacity | G-Type: 150% rated current for 60s; 180% for 3s |
| Motor Types Supported | Induction motor (IM), PMSM, synchronous reluctance motor, high-speed spindle motor |
| DC Reactor | Built-in DC reactor (standard) |
| EMC Filter | Built-in enhanced C2/C3 filter |
| Braking Unit | Built-in braking chopper (external braking resistor optional) |
| Digital Inputs | 6 * multi-function DI (PNP/NPN selectable), 1 * high-speed pulse input |
| Analog Inputs | 2 * 0–10V / 4–20mA |
| Digital Outputs | 1 * relay output, 1 * transistor output, 1 * high-speed pulse output |
| Analog Outputs | 2 * 0–10V / 4–20mA |
| Encoder Interface | Standard incremental encoder input (ABZ, UVW); optional resolver and absolute encoder cards |
| Communication (Standard) | RS485 Modbus RTU |
| Communication (Optional) | PROFIBUS-DP, PROFINET, EtherCAT, CANopen, DeviceNet, Ethernet/IP |
| Built-in PLC | Programmable logic with function blocks, timers, counters, comparators, math operations; simple positioning and electronic gear |
| Built-in Functions | PID controller (multi-channel, sleep/wake), multi-pump constant pressure, tension control (taper calc), wobble frequency, flying start, DC braking, S-curve, slip compensation, AVR, torque limit, master/slave, spindle positioning |
| Protection Features | Overcurrent, overvoltage, undervoltage, overload, overheating, input phase loss, output phase loss, short-circuit to ground, PTC motor protection, communication fault |
| Enclosure Rating | IP20 |
| Cooling Method | Forced air cooling (independent air duct, built-in DC fan) |
| Ambient Temperature | -10°C to +50°C (derating above 40°C); coated PCBA for 3C3 environments |
| Humidity | ≤95% RH, non-condensing |
| Altitude | ≤1000m (derating above 1000m) |
| Dimensions (W*H*D) | Approx. 100 * 270 * 165 mm |
| Net Weight | Approx. 3.5 kg |
| Certifications | CE, RoHS, ISO 9001 |
